文章分类:程序软件

关键词:人工智能编程软件、机器学习、深度学习框架、案例故事

一、背景介绍
随着人工智能技术的飞速发展,机器学习成为推动科技进步的重要驱动力之一。为了实现机器学习的功能,需要一种强大的工具——人工智能编程软件和深度学习框架。这些软件为开发者提供了丰富的库和工具集,帮助他们构建复杂的机器学习模型,并推动人工智能技术在各个领域的应用。接下来,我们将通过具体案例来探讨人工智能编程软件和深度学习框架的重要性及其应用场景。

二、案例故事:自动驾驶汽车的研发之旅

案例选取:自动驾驶汽车的研发过程中,人工智能编程软件和深度学习框架的应用。

起因:随着交通拥堵、安全事故频发以及人们对出行安全需求的提升,自动驾驶汽车逐渐成为科技领域的研究热点。为了打造一辆具备自动驾驶功能的汽车,团队需要借助先进的编程软件和深度学习框架来实现车辆的自主决策和导航功能。

经过:

  1. 数据收集与处理:团队首先通过摄像头、雷达等传感器收集大量的道路数据。这些数据将被用于训练机器学习模型。
  2. 选择深度学习框架:为了处理这些数据并构建机器学习模型,团队选择了TensorFlow作为他们的深度学习框架。TensorFlow具备强大的计算能力和灵活性,使得团队能够快速地构建和训练模型。
  3. 模型训练与优化:团队利用TensorFlow构建了一个深度学习模型,用于识别道路标志、障碍物以及其他车辆。接着,他们使用大量的道路数据对模型进行训练,并通过不断调整参数来优化模型的性能。
  4. 软件开发与集成:在完成模型的训练和优化后,团队开始开发自动驾驶汽车的控制软件。他们使用C++和其他编程语言编写代码,将深度学习模型集成到汽车的控制系统中。
  5. 测试与验证:最后,团队对自动驾驶汽车进行了大量的路测和模拟测试,以确保车辆在各种路况下都能安全、稳定地行驶。

结果:经过长时间的研究和开发,团队成功地开发出了一款具备自动驾驶功能的汽车。这款汽车能够在各种路况下自主驾驶,大大提高了出行的安全性和便捷性。此外,通过使用TensorFlow等深度学习框架和编程软件,团队大大提高了开发效率和模型性能。

三、总结
人工智能编程软件和深度学习框架在自动驾驶汽车的研发过程中起到了至关重要的作用。它们不仅提高了开发效率,还使得模型的性能得到了大幅提升。随着科技的不断发展,人工智能编程软件和深度学习框架将在更多领域得到应用,推动科技进步和社会发展。